1989 Jeep Cherokee vs. 2011 Peugeot 207
To start off, 2011 Peugeot 207 is newer by 22 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1989 Jeep Cherokee.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1989 Jeep Cherokee would be higher. At 2,068 cc (4 cylinders), 1989 Jeep Cherokee is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Peugeot 207 (110 HP) has 23 more horse power than 1989 Jeep Cherokee. (87 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2011 Peugeot 207 should accelerate faster than 1989 Jeep Cherokee.
Because 1989 Jeep Cherokee is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2011 Peugeot 207.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1989 Jeep Cherokee will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
